Summary
A female employee has a sleepwalking disorder. During a business conference, she walked into her male colleague's room in the middle of the night and encroached upon his privacy. The man, who was married, was petrified. The woman was very apologetic after she woke up to realize what had happened. Despite her having a history of good behavior and performance, it is recommended that she is fired after this incident. The woman asserted that it is wrong and illegal to terminate someone due to their disability. What is the best course of action and why?
